Egyptian Businessman Faces Drug Charges

A 43-year-old Egyptian businessman is standing trial before the High Criminal Court on charges of possessing hashish and psychotropic substances for trafficking and personal use. The case followed confidential information received by the Anti-Narcotics Directorate about a network allegedly importing and distributing drugs for financial gain.

Police searching the defendant’s home allegedly found 145 bottles containing a liquid substance believed to be manufactured hashish, weighing more than 3,000 grammes, along with nearly half a kilogramme of manufactured hashish, drug-containing sprays and more than 100 drug-soaked sheets. Investigators also found suspected drug-related photos, videos and financial transaction records on his mobile phone, while forensic tests detected psychotropic substances in his urine.

The Public Prosecution referred the defendant to trial, and he denied the charges at yesterday’s hearing. The court adjourned the case to September 21 to allow the defence to review the documents and obtain a copy of the case file.
